Handover note — Crumbwheel order cutoffs.

Welcome aboard. The bakery cutoff rule in Crumbwheel closes same-day orders at 14:00 local to each storefront, not UTC — this has bitten us twice. Holiday overrides live in the calendar service and take precedence silently, so always check there first when a cutoff looks wrong. To unlock the calendar service's admin console after a restart, enter the recovery passphrase below.

vault phrase of bagap-bahaf = silion-pelox-sorox-casdor-quenwyn-fraax-eliox-praael-kelion-quenvan-kasox-rusael-norius-belvan

## Pinning deps on Larkspindle

Quick reminder: we pin everything on Larkspindle, no floating ranges, ever. If a page fires about a broken build, odds are someone bumped a transitive dep without updating the lockfile. Regenerate it with the pinning script, not by hand — Tove's tooling handles the hashes. Before regenerating, make sure your environment matches the values listed below.

service settings:
HOLATH_HOST=holath.qorvelsys.internal
HOLATH_PORT=9000

## Alert: StatRelay Sidecar Flush Lag

This alert fires when the StatRelay metrics-aggregation sidecar falls more than 120 seconds behind on flushing buffered samples to the Coalmine backend. Plugin-emitted counters are buffered in-process, so sustained lag usually means a plugin is emitting unbounded label cardinality or blocking the flush thread. Check your plugin's metric registration against the published cardinality limits before escalating. If the lag persists after your plugin is ruled out, contact the telemetry team.

escalation mailbox, bagug-fahof: novdor.wendor.jormir@norvalabs.example